Delete vs Drop in Database: Key Differences
Delete and drop are both database operation statements, but their purposes are different.
- Delete: Used to remove records from the database, specifically deleting one or multiple rows of data from a table while maintaining the structure and other data. The delete operation can be performed based on certain conditions, such as specifying to delete records that meet specific criteria.
- Drop: Used to delete an entire table, including its structure and all of its data. The Drop operation is irreversible, once the Drop command is executed, the data and structure of the table cannot be recovered. Drop is typically used to empty an entire table or remove a table that is no longer needed.
